Back at EA Play 2020, EA finally announced that its popular Skate series is finally returning. Of course, given the massive fan campaign and the success of indie games like Skater XL and Session, it's not surprising to see EA go back to the Skate well. And the success of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 1+2 has to be a good sign for the company. However, there were still several unknowns about the title. Thankfully, one of those has been announced today. Skate finally has its own studio, as EA announced Full Circle, a brand new team based in Vancouver. See

As you can see if you click through the tweet above, they're very much still staffing up. When they announced the next Skate it definitely seemed pretty far out and this kind of confirms that assumption. It looks like they're hiring quite a few positions across the board. I wouldn't expect this game any time soon.

That being said, it is comforting to see EA putting together a studio for Skate. It signifies to me that they're serious about development. That's not a big surprise given how loud the community has been about wanting this game, but it's nice to see that confirmed.
